Showcase Your Best Work
- Take screenshots of your website in its best state.
- Clients might upload low-quality images or change colors, ruining your original design.
List Technologies
- List the technologies used in each project.
- This helps viewers understand your skillset and avoids them having to guess.
Describe Problems Solved
- Briefly describe the problems you solved for each project.
- Explain how you used specific technologies to address client challenges.
